Finance Review — Kestrel Works Capacity Decision

For branch managers. Expansion at the Ashgrove plant clears the hurdle rate; the Merrow site does not. Capex ceiling: 4.5M. Depreciation impact modelled over eight years. Working capital needs rise in Q2. Decision due end of month. The board's confidential direction on this is recorded below.

confidential, kagup-bafog: Fraaxax Group is in early talks to buy Soroxox Group for about $343.8 million. The Olidor launch date is June 14, and nothing goes to the press before then. Legal wants the Aldmirek Logistics term sheet signed before July 23.

Handover note — Crumbwheel order cutoffs.

Welcome aboard. The bakery cutoff rule in Crumbwheel closes same-day orders at 14:00 local to each storefront, not UTC — this has bitten us twice. Holiday overrides live in the calendar service and take precedence silently, so always check there first when a cutoff looks wrong. To unlock the calendar service's admin console after a restart, enter the recovery passphrase below.

vault phrase of bagap-bahaf = silion-pelox-sorox-casdor-quenwyn-fraax-eliox-praael-kelion-quenvan-kasox-rusael-norius-belvan

Ticket #FD-2291 — Visitor handling, Kestrelmoor House lobby. New starters: all visitors sign in at the front desk, get a red lanyard, and must be escorted at all times. No exceptions for couriers. Log departures too. If the desk is unstaffed, use the intercom by the turnstile. The gate reader accepts the standard staff pass below.

door code, yagap-bahof: bdg-O-05

## Changelog — Font vendoring defaults changed

As of this release, the Bracken UI build no longer fetches third-party fonts at build time. All typefaces used by the Lanternwell suite are now vendored into the repo under a dedicated assets directory, and the fetch step is skipped by default. If you're onboarding, nothing to install — the fonts travel with the checkout. The build flags controlling this behavior are listed below.

settings of hadup-yafog:
LAMAEL_PIN=3761
LAMAEL_TENANT=istmir
LAMAEL_METRICS_HOST=metrics.lamael.plorvasys.test
LAMAEL_SEAL=seal_8ea68500
LAMAEL_STANDBY_TEAM=fraok